Why do divers fan the bottom rather than dig at it? seems to really mess up visibility.
@DetectorComparisons
@DetectorComparisons 9 жыл бұрын
BJOlson It depends on the bottom. If its mostly sand/rocks fanning clears out a large area quickly. If you just claw the bottom, rocks and sand will collapse right back into the hole. If there is a slight current, the visibility clears up quickly.

For stuff like that wouldn't it be good to have a much larger coil?
@DetectorComparisons
@DetectorComparisons 9 жыл бұрын
You would go a little deeper with a larger coil but recovering the targets and swinging the machine would be a little more challenging. The biggest problem would be the hole caving in; once you get down 8-10", its hard getting the target out.
